如何实现Java的String转long越界

1. 流程图

flowchart TD
    A(开始) --> B(创建一个String变量)
    B --> C(将String转换为long)
    C --> D(判断是否越界)
    D --> E(处理越界情况)
    E --> F(结束)

2. 详细步骤

步骤表格

步骤 操作
1 创建一个String变量
2 将String转换为long
3 判断是否越界
4 处理越界情况

具体操作

步骤1:创建一个String变量
String str = "9223372036854775807"; // 定义一个String变量,并赋值为long类型的最大值
步骤2:将String转换为long
long num = Long.parseLong(str); // 使用Long.parseLong方法将String转换为long
步骤3:判断是否越界
if (num < Long.MIN_VALUE || num > Long.MAX_VALUE) {
    // 处理越界情况
}
步骤4:处理越界情况
System.out.println("转换后的long值越界"); // 打印越界信息

结尾

通过以上步骤,你可以实现Java的String转long并处理越界情况。希望这篇文章对你有所帮助,如果有任何疑问或者需要进一步的解释,欢迎随时联系我。加油!努力学习,不断进步!